rss

Профиль компании

Финансовые компании

Блог компании Os_Engine | Индикатор Aroon и бесплатные роботы на нём.

Сегодня мы рассмотрим индикатор Aroon. Узнаем историю создания индикатора и то, как он рассчитывается.

Также к данной статье будут прикреплены готовые скрипты роботов на этом индикаторе с возможностью торговать на нашей платформе OsEngine.

Индикатор Aroon и бесплатные роботы на нём.

Оглавление

1.      История создания индикатора Aroon.

2.      Как проводятся расчеты индикатора Aroon.

3.      Какие сигналы может подавать индикатор Aroon.

4.      Роботы для OsEngine на индикаторе Aroon.

4.1.   Пробой Parabolic SAR и Aroon.

4.2.   Контртрендовая стратегия на индикаторах Stochastic и Aroon.

5.      Итоговая таблица результатов.

 

1. История создания индикатора Aroon.

Aroon является техническим индикатором, который используется для измерения силы и направления тренда на рынке. Он был разработан Тушаром Чанде в 1995 году и получил свое название от слова «a-roon», которое в переводе с санскрита означает «рассвет».

Чанд провел некоторые исследования в области технического анализа и выяснил, что время, прошедшее с момента наивысшего и наименьшего значений цены, может быть полезной информацией для определения силы тренда. Он создал индикатор Aroon, который вычисляет эти временные интервалы и отображает их на графике в виде двух линий — Aroon Up и Aroon Down.

Aroon Up отображает процент времени, прошедший с момента формирования максимума за период N до текущего момента и показывает, насколько сильно рынок находится в восходящем тренде. Если значение равно 100%, это означает, что новый максимум был достигнут недавно. Если значение равно 0%, это значит, что с момента последнего максимума прошло всё время периода N. Aroon Down отображает процент времени, прошедший с момента формирования минимума за период N до текущего момента и отражает силу нисходящего тренда. Значения интерпретируются аналогично Aroon Up. Обе линии колеблются между 0 и 100, где значения ближе к 100 указывают на сильный тренд, а ближе к 0 — на слабый.

Индикатор Aroon является полезным инструментом для технического анализа и может помочь трейдерам принимать более обоснованные решения на финансовых рынках.

 

2. Как проводятся расчеты индикатора Aroon.

Aroon Up = 100 * (N — numBarUp) / N

Aroon Down = 100 * (N — numBarDown) / N

где

  • N — период расчета индикатора,
  • numBarUp — количество свечей от последнего максимума,
  • numBarDown — количество свечей от последнего минимума.

Расчёт индикатора в OsEngine можно посмотреть вот в этом файле:

https://github.com/AlexWan/OsEngine/blob/master/project/OsEngine/bin/Debug/Custom/Indicators/Scripts/Aroon.cs

 

3. Какие сигналы может подавать индикатор Aroon.

1. Пересечение линий: когда линия Aroon Up пересекает линию Aroon Down сверху вниз, это может быть сигналом о начале нисходящей тенденции на рынке. А когда линия Aroon Down пересекает линию Aroon Up сверху вниз, это может быть сигналом о начале восходящей тенденции на рынке.

2. Сила тренда: когда одна из линий находятся в зоне 70-100, то на рынке сильный тренд. Если значение одной из линий 50-70, то возможно продолжение тенденции.

3. Сигнал консолидации: если линии Aroon Up и Aroon Down часто пересекаются, это предполагает баланс спроса и предложения, неопределенность в настроениях и состояние флэта. И когда обе линии находятся ниже 50, так же может сигнализировать о консолидации.

 

4. Роботы для OsEngine на индикаторе Aroon.

4.1. Пробой Parabolic SAR и Aroon.

https://github.com/AlexWan/OsEngine/blob/master/project/OsEngine/bin/Debug/Custom/Robots/BreakParabolicAndAroon.cs

Ссылка на Parabolic Sar:

https://github.com/AlexWan/OsEngine/blob/master/project/OsEngine/bin/Debug/Custom/Indicators/Scripts/ParabolicSAR.cs

Логика входа:

  • Покупаем, когда цена выше значения Parabolic SAR и линия Aroon Up выше 50 и выше линии Aroon Down.
  • Продаём, когда цена ниже значения Parabolic SAR и линия Aroon Down выше 50 и выше линии Aroon Up.

Выход:

  • Из покупки, когда цена ниже значения Parabolic SAR.
  • Из продажи, когда цена выше значения Parabolic SAR.
Индикатор Aroon и бесплатные роботы на нём.
Рис. 1. Пример логики.

Индикатор Aroon и бесплатные роботы на нём.
Рис. 2. Si, TF15 min, 2021-24, P/L 1 contract: 0,29%

Индикатор Aroon и бесплатные роботы на нём.
Рис. 3. BR, TF15 min, 2021-24, P/L 1 contract: 0,46%

Индикатор Aroon и бесплатные роботы на нём.
Рис. 4. BTCUSDT, TF15 min, 2021-24, P/L 1 contract: 0,3%

Индикатор Aroon и бесплатные роботы на нём.
Рис. 5. ETHUSDT, TF15 min, 2021-24, P/L 1 contract: 0,25%

 

4.2. Контртрендовая стратегия на индикаторах Stochastic и Aroon.

https://github.com/AlexWan/OsEngine/blob/master/project/OsEngine/bin/Debug/Custom/Robots/ContrtrendStochAndAroon.cs

Ссылка на Stochastic:

https://github.com/AlexWan/OsEngine/blob/master/project/OsEngine/bin/Debug/Custom/Indicators/Scripts/Stochastic.cs

Логика входа:

  • Покупаем, когда линия Aroon Up выше 70, и Stochastic вышел из зоны перепроданности (выше 30).
  • Продаём, когда линия Aroon Down выше 70, и Stochastic вышел из зоны перекупленности (ниже 80).

Выход:

  • Из покупки, когда линия Aroon Up ниже 60.
  • Из продажи, когда линия Aroon Down ниже 60.

Индикатор Aroon и бесплатные роботы на нём.
Рис. 6. Пример логики.

Индикатор Aroon и бесплатные роботы на нём.
Рис. 7. Si, TF15 min, 2021-24, P/L 1 contract: 0,11%

Индикатор Aroon и бесплатные роботы на нём.
Рис. 8. BR, TF15 min, 2021-24, P/L 1 contract: 0,28%

Индикатор Aroon и бесплатные роботы на нём.
Рис. 9. BTCUSDT, TF15 min, 2021-24, P/L 1 contract: 0,2%

Индикатор Aroon и бесплатные роботы на нём.
Рис. 10. ETHUSDT, TF15 min, 2021-24, P/L 1 contract: 0,34%

 

5. Итоговая таблица результатов.

Индикатор Aroon и бесплатные роботы на нём.

Лучшие результаты у нас показала стратегия, основанная на индикаторах Parabolic SAR и Aroon.

* Информация представлена по расчетам OsEngine https://github.com/AlexWan/OsEngine 

Ссылки на роботов на GitHub:

  1. https://github.com/AlexWan/OsEngine/blob/master/project/OsEngine/bin/Debug/Custom/Robots/BreakParabolicAndAroon.cs
  2. https://github.com/AlexWan/OsEngine/blob/master/project/OsEngine/bin/Debug/Custom/Robots/ContrtrendStochAndAroon.cs

Пост из серии «Роботы и индикаторы»

Из данных статей Вы узнаете базовую информацию о том или ином индикаторе. А также можно посмотреть роботов на данных индикаторах с исходным кодом. 

Оглавление здесь: https://smart-lab.ru/company/os_engine/blog

Что почитать по алготрейдингу?

1) Сборник статей по парному арбитражу: https://smart-lab.ru/company/os_engine/blog/948250.php

2) Сборник статей по валютному арбитражу: https://smart-lab.ru/company/os_engine/blog/965051.php

3) Сборник статей по индексному арбитражу: https://smart-lab.ru/company/os_engine/blog/997533.php

4) Как стать программистом и изменить свою жизнь: https://smart-lab.ru/company/os_engine/blog/982134.php 

OsEngine: https://github.com/AlexWan/OsEngine
FAQ: https://o-s-a.net/os-engine-faq
Поддержка OsEngine: https://t.me/osengine_official_support

Регистрируйся в АЛОР и получай бонусы: https://www.alorbroker.ru/open
Сайт АЛОР БРОКЕР: https://www.alorbroker.ru
Раздел «Для клиентов»: https://www.alorbroker.ru/openinfo/for-clients
Программа лояльности от АЛОР БРОКЕР и OsEngine: https://smart-lab.ru/company/os_engine/blog/972745.php

Индикатор Aroon и бесплатные роботы на нём.

★3

UPDONW
Новый дизайн